What is the mascot for Euro 2021?

EURO 2021 – Skillzy the unloved. UEFA unveiled this Friday, May 28, the mascot of Euro 2021, which succeeds Super Victor, in 2016.

Who is Skillzy?

Meet Skillzy, Euro 2020 “larger-than-life” mascot. The big-eyed, cartoonish mascot, who also sports a topknot, was introduced by the hand of freestylers Liv Cooke and Tobias Becs, before showing off his own skills (or should that be “skillz”?).

Where is the Euro 2020 hosted?

Wembley Stadium was the setting for the UEFA EURO 2020 decider as Italy won their second title by beating England on penalties. There were 11 host cities in all, but both semi-finals and the final took place in London.

What were the mascots name in 2012 Euro championship?

The UEFA EURO 2012 mascots will be called Slavek and Slavko after the results of a poll of 39,233 people was announced in Kyiv. Slavek and Slavko received 56% of the votes, finishing well clear of the other sets of names – Siemko & Strimko and Klemek & Ladko – in a fortnight-long ballot.

Who was the only team to defeat England in 2020 qualifiers?

EURO facts: England Southgate’s side finished top of Group A in UEFA EURO 2020 qualifying, winning seven of their eight matches (L1) to progress six points ahead of the Czech Republic. A 2-1 loss in Prague was England’s sole defeat.

What is the 2020 Olympic mascot?

Miraitowa
The cartoony Miraitowa is the official mascot of the Tokyo Olympics, and it comes with surprising powers the athletes can only envy. Every Olympics has its own mascot, officially hailed as the ambassador of the Games. Tokyo has two: Miraitowa for the Olympics and Someity for the Paralympic Games.
